Overview / Responsibilities:
The Training & Competence Advisor will support the management of Wood’s technical resource pool through the delivery of Competence recording and assurance services across the business, ensuring our workforce has the correct competencies and certification as mandated by statute, client, or internal standards to carry out their role safely.
- Support the delivery and monitoring of mandatory technical and safety training courses and certification.
- Ensure project and client specific competence requirements are achieved.
- Contributes to developing and retaining motivated and competent people, and to assuring the safe delivery of services by competent personnel.
- Drive mandatory training and competence compliance progress.
- Training Matrix compliance management, monitoring and reporting (incl. client specific reports).
- Support in the development of mandatory training processes.
- Develop standardised reporting on Competence data quality allowing for accurate analysis.
- Provide the business with support and advice on competence matters.
- Review training and competence frameworks in line with business and industry requirements and standards.
- Coordinate and support technical training and competence programmes.
- Support internal and external competence assurance activities including audits.
- Conduct training gap analysis.
- Run accurate pre-employment mandatory certification compliance checks.
- Monitor and manage exceptions and deviations to mandatory certification requirements.
- Monitor the renewal of expiring certification and initiate escalation where appropriate.
- Maintenance of Training & Competence Management Systems - training records data entry and competence portfolios.
- Manage and administer competence-related pay increments.
- Source external training providers, agencies and accredited bodies where necessary to meet legislative and industry standard.

Skills / Qualifications:
**Qualifications**:

- Typically qualified to ISCED Level 6 (Bachelors or equivalent) or has achieved a similar level of expertise through a combination of education and experience.

**Knowledge, skills and experience**:

- Typically requires some Training & Competence experience, preferably in a highly regulated process industry.
- Intermediate or advanced knowledge of MS Office, in particular Excel, Word and Outlook.
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
- Ability to manage a high volume of work and to prioritise.
- Clear understanding of technical disciplines and associated competencies.
- Ability to analyse data and provide recommendations on findings.
- Capability to advise and support on training and competence programmes.
- Knowledge of applicable regulatory framework and associated legislation.

**Personal attributes**:

- Good interpersonal skills; interacts with others in a positive and professional manner at all times.
- Problem solver that is curious in their approach.
- Attention to detail.
- Demonstrates integrity and honesty.
- Flexible, adaptable and open minded.
